1. Stick to a schedule 

All the comforts and privileges of working from home are in the palm of your hand to either harness effectively or take for granted. It can be either boon or bane depending on how you manage it.  

The best way to reap the benefits – for your organization and for yourself – is to be decisive in starting and finishing your work at the same time each day. Whether you’re a morning person or a night owl, accomplishing your tasks during specific set hours, where you’re most alert and energetic, is critical to success.

2. Have a dedicated workspace 

While working from home means that you can work from anywhere it should not mean that you work from everywhere – it’s best for you and your family that you separate work from home as much as possible.  Find the most ideal home office station that can be exclusively used for working. There is no one-size-fits-all layout that works for everyone but it should be within an area that is conducive for creativity and productivity – peacefully and without interruption – which at the end of the day, you can walk away from but still worth looking forward to going back to the following morning – but with a much shorter commute than those who don’t work from home.

4. Prioritize communication 

Spontaneous communication, visibility, and status updates are three keyfor a successful WFH business setting. Always keep the lines of communication open to let your team know that you are available and taking WFH seriously.

5. Find a balance between work and life 

Try not to let work spill over, both literally and figuratively, into your personal space and life. In the same manner, don’t let family obligations or personal issues get in the way of completing pending work.  

Having regular breaks is just as important as sticking a routine when working from home. Tips such as implementing a ‘no phone zone’ during your designated work hours can help you get done what needs to be done much faster. Plus it will you look forward to spending more meaningful time with your loved ones “after work.
